#3a543e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3a543e is composed of 22.7% red, 32.9%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.2%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 129.2 degrees, a saturation of 18.3% and a lightness of 27.8%. #3a543e color hex could be obtained by blending #74a87c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#3a543e color description : Very dark grayish lime green.
#3a543e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3a543e has RGB values of R:58, G:84,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0, Y:0.26,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 3822654.
